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: (1) patients with myasthenia gravis graded as MGFA class II-IV (myathenia gravis foundation of america); (2) positive serum anti-acetylcholine receptor antibodies (AchR Ab); (3) patients aged <=75 years; (4) myasthenia gravis complicated with thymoma of Masaoka-Koga stage I, II or III.
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: (1) myasthenic weakness requiring intubation (MGFA Class V); (2) daily usage of pyridostigmine >=360mg; (3) patients with impaired cardiac, kidney, liver or lung function and had a great risk; (4) patients who refuse to undergo R-SET or VAT-SET.
